Chanoine Freres is one of the oldest Champagne Houses in Epernay. In 1730, during the reign of Louis XV, the brothers Jacques-Louis and Jean-Baptiste Chanoine established a company trading in the wines of Champagne under the name of Chanoine Freres.

Also in 1730, the brothers were granted permission by the town of Epernay to begin excavation of the very first Champagne cellars. The Chanoine brothers, true pioneers of today's Champagne business, travelled the length and breadth of Europe introducing their wines to new markets but there is no question that the foremost export market for Champagne in the XIXth century was Tsarist Russia.

Chanoine Freres have created the Cuvee Tsarine in honour of Tsarist Russia, and those halcyon days. The bottle design evokes the swirling spires of St. Basil’s Cathedral in Moscow and the opulence of pre-revolutionary Imperial Russia.
